Excel macro vba or. In this chapter learn how to create a simple macro. One way of getting the vba code is to record the macro and take the code it generates. In excel macro code is a programming code which is written in vba visual basic for applications language. With excel vba you can automate tasks in excel by writing so called macros.
In this chapter learn how to create a simple macro which will be executed after clicking on a command button. Go to the file tab options. Microsoft excel determines whether to allow or disallow vba codes to run based on the macro setting selected in the trust center which is the place where you configure all the security settings for excel. Vba macros save time as they automate repetitive tasks.
1 create a macro. Vba is the programming language excel uses to create macros. However that code by macro recorder is often full of code that is not really needed. Also macro recorder has some limitations.
Click the run tab on the ribbon. Select run subuserform from the dropdown list. It is a piece of programming code that runs in an excel environment but you dont need to be a coder to program macros. Using excel macros can speed up work and save you a lot of time.
Macros are a series of pre recorded commands. This example activates the cell three columns to the right of and three rows down from the active cell on sheet1. With excel vba you can automate tasks in excel by writing so called macros. Excel macro is a record and playback tool that simply records your excel steps and the macro will play it back as many times as you want.
You can test your macro code from the vba editor itself. The message box with the string you typed appears in your worksheet. Vba vba visual basic for applications is the programming language of excel and other office programs. The idea behind using a macro code is to automate an action which you perform manually in excel otherwise.